Ferro vanadium is an important alloying agent used in the production of high-strength steel. The market for ferro vanadium in Norway is driven by demand from the construction, automotive, and aerospace industries, where durable and lightweight materials are essential.
The ferro vanadium market in Norway is driven by the demand for ferroalloys used to improve the strength and hardness of steel and other alloys. Ferro vanadium is essential for producing high-strength steel and other high-performance materials. The market benefits from advancements in ferroalloy production technologies, increasing demand for high-quality steel products, and the growing focus on enhancing material properties.
The ferro vanadium market in Norway is impacted by the fluctuating prices of vanadium and the environmental concerns associated with its extraction and processing. Additionally, competition from alternative alloying materials poses a challenge to the markets growth.
Government policies in Norways ferro vanadium market aim to ensure the safety and sustainability of vanadium alloy production. Regulations require that ferro vanadium products meet performance and environmental standards. The government supports research and development in vanadium technologies to enhance their applications in steelmaking and other industrial processes.
